Alexandra Reinhardt

Alexandra is the Community Partnership Coordinator for Baptist Medical Center Clay, serving as the liaison between hospital and community. Specifically, she is responsible for building community relationships, guiding strategic investments in Clay County that advance Baptist’s mission, and managing hospital volunteers. 

In her role she also represents Baptist on several local committees that address community health and well-being. Currently, Alexandra chairs the Department of Health workgroup tasked with working collaboratively to improve healthcare access within the community by eliminating the barriers residents face in addressing their primary and specialty care needs. Recently, Alexandra’s research to her hospital system’s c-suite led to $26,000 in donations to local food pantries coupled with an awareness campaign centered on food insecurity based on responses from employee surveys. 

For the 2023-2024 year, Alexandra was selected for two prestigious fellowships. The first with the United Way of Northeast Florida for their Stein Fellowship Class to celebrate 100 years in Jacksonville. The fellowship focuses on volunteer service and philanthropic initiatives including veteran services and full-service schools aimed at providing wrap around care to low-income students. Through this fellowship, she also serves as a Big Sister meeting weekly to help with schoolwork and provide a friendly support system. Her fellowship also includes a capstone project as a Board Fellow with Sanctuary on 8th, coincidentally a Junior League of Jacksonville supported agency. She was also chosen by the Non-Profit Center of Northeast Florida for their non-profit board development program. Through this, she is paired with local non-profit Waste Not Want Not that rescues over a million pound of food a year. Alexandra served as a board fellow participating in board meetings, strategic planning, and food rescue, having personally rescued 900 pounds of food from her employer within the first six months of partnership. She was elected to the board of directors in 2024.

Alexandra is an active member of the  Junior League of Jacksonville , serving as Executive Vice President during its historic 100th year (2023-2024). Alexandra also serves on the Clay Education Foundation Board and volunteers for the PFA at her son’s school.
